Heathrow Airport, located in London, is one of the busiest air travel hubs in the world. It serves as a major international gateway, connecting passengers to destinations across the globe. One of the popular routes from Heathrow is the flight to Frankfurt, which is a key business and financial hub in Germany.
For many business travelers, flying from Heathrow to Frankfurt is a common occurrence. With the two cities being major economic centers, there is a high demand for this route. As a result, airlines operate multiple flights throughout the day to accommodate the needs of passengers.
When it comes to the flight status of Heathrow to Frankfurt, there are several factors to consider. Weather conditions, air traffic control, and airport operations all play a role in the on-time performance of flights. Additionally, mechanical issues and crew availability can also impact the status of a flight.
For passengers looking to keep track of their flight status, there are several resources available. Most airlines provide real-time flight status updates on their websites and mobile apps. These updates include information on departure and arrival times, gate assignments, and any delays or cancellations. Passengers can also sign up for flight alerts to receive notifications on their mobile devices.
In addition to airline-provided information, passengers can also check the flight status at Heathrow Airport. The airport鈥檚 official website offers a live flight tracker, allowing users to search for specific flights and view their status. This can be particularly useful for those meeting arriving passengers or those with connecting flights.
For those who prefer a more personalized approach, contacting the airline directly can provide up-to-date information on the flight status. Most airlines have dedicated customer service lines and social media channels where passengers can inquire about their flights.
When it comes to flying from Heathrow to Frankfurt, there are a number of major airlines that operate on this route. Lufthansa, British Airways, and Eurowings are among the carriers that offer regular flights between the two cities. Each airline has its own schedule and frequency of flights, giving passengers options to choose from based on their travel preferences.
The duration of the flight from Heathrow to Frankfurt is typically around 1 hour and 30 minutes. This makes it a convenient and time-efficient option for travelers looking to make the journey between the two cities. With multiple flights available throughout the day, passengers can choose a departure time that best suits their schedule.
